Patricia Louise Jones passed away peacefully at her home in Beckley, WV on June 19th 2026 at the age of 78.

She was born in Longacre, WV and spent her childhood in Barrett WV, specifically living in Boss’s Camp. She graduated Salutatorian from Van High School in 1965. She received a Bachelor’s degree in Education from Morris Harvey College and a Master’s degree from Marshall University. She followed in her mother’s footsteps and pursued a career in teaching. She was a teacher and principal at Wharton Junior High before coming to Van High School where she taught English, Literature, Creative Writing, Speech, and Classics. She was known for her immense vocabulary and love of reading. Her favorite book was definitely Gone with The Wind, which she required many of her students to read. She was passionate about her students learning. Her pupils left her classroom well prepared for college and capable of being articulate members of society. She personified leading with grace, class, and style. Many will recall her signature red color and vast collection of high heels. Although, she did love donning her gold and blue to cheer on the Bulldogs and the Mountaineers. She was respected and adored by her students and colleagues. Serving 35 years in the public school system, she leaves a lasting impact on generations of students and the Van community.
